Keeping Up with the Kardashians - Season 11

Season 11

Episodes

That Was Then This Is Now
The daughters have to find a way to support Caitlyn while still being sensitive to Kris's feelings; Kourtney focuses on her kids after of asking Scott to move out; Kim wants Khloé to do the sexiest photoshoot she's ever done.

The Price You Pay
Kourtney attempts to find a new status quo with Scott; a business trip to Australia has Khloé thinking twice about how much she does for her sisters; Kim and Kanye prepare to move back in with Kim.

Rites of Passage
Kris decides to throw an extra-special graduation party for Kylie; Kim's pregnancy cravings take her halfway around the world, but it could be putting her at risk; Khloé responds to a presence in her house by getting in touch with her psychic side.

All Grown Up
Kris a reason to meet Caitlyn for the first time at Kylie's 18th birthday; Kim takes over Kris's home in preparation for baby number two; Khloé takes steps to move forward.

Lions and Tigers and Texts
After moving forward with her divorce, Khloé seeks solace in Mexico City at the big cat rescue foundation; Kris has on her own separate correspondence with Lamar; Kylie makes her first appearance as an adult at a club in Montreal.

Non-Bon Voyage
The family flies to St. Bart's to forget their troubles, but drama follows them; Kourtney gets disturbing news about Scott; Kendall has beef with Kylie for bringing her boyfriend Tyga; Kris struggles to get back on Kim's good side.

Return from Paradise
Kendall feels neglected when Kylie continues to give Tyga all her attention. Kim and Khloe make it their mission to make Kourtney feel good. An unexpected visit from Scott triggers a whirlwind of emotions when the family finally sits down with Scott to discuss the mistakes he made.

The Big Launch
The Kardashian and Jenner girls travel to New York to launch their new apps.

Fear of the Unknown
Kris wants the girls to take a genetic test to know their risks for cancer, but not everyone is on board; Kendall has a hard to finding a balance in her relationship with Caitlyn; the family helps Scott as he hits a low point.

Miscommunication
Kris decides the family needs Communication Therapy; Kylie is ready to celebrate her new home but her family's bossy ways get in the way of her plans; Khloé struggles to finish her book.

The Great Kris
Kim leads the planning for a grand 60th birthday party for Kris but is afraid she may have taken on too much at nine months pregnant; Scott finally goes into rehab, but only time will tell if he is ready to change.

Family First
The girls remake a legendary family video for Kris's epic 60th birthday bash; Khloé has a hard time finding a balance between supporting Lamar and returning to her daily life; Kendall gets an amazing opportunity.

Unforeseen Future
Kim learns that her house construction is delayed even further, leaving her living situation in limbo; Scott comes back from rehab ready to prove he is a changed man; Kylie confronts Kendall about being a team.

It's Always Sunny in Philadelphia
It's Always Sunny in Philadelphia is an American comedy series about four friends in their late 20s with clear sociopathic tendencies who run an unsuccessful Irish bar, "Paddy's Pub," in South Philadelphia. The series deals with a variety of controversial topics, including abortion, gun control, physical disabilities, racism, sexism, religion, the Israeli/Palestinian situation, terrorism, transsexuality, slavery, incest, sexual harassment in education, the homeless, statutory rape, drug addiction, pedophilia, child abuse, mental illness, gay rights and dumpster babies.
